Section 29A of the Insolvency and Bankruptcy Code, 2016 has emerged as one of the key statutes in determining the eligibility of Resolution Applicants in the Corporate Insolvency Resolution Process. The Code, in its original form had not incorporated any provisions to prevent defaulting promoters from buying-back the corporate debtor, which could occur potentially at steep discounts.
International termination charge (ITC) is the charge payable by an Indian International Long-Distance Operator (ILDO), who carries the call from outside the country, to the access provider in the country in whose network the call terminates. Credit Guarantee Fund for Micro Units- Overview & Alterations by Management Committee What is a credit guarantee fund? Credit guarantee fund is a type of fund which backs up the loan taken by the beneficiaries as a form of collateral.
